What is Garden Tea?

Garden tea is simple. All you do is collect anything you’d put in a compost. Accept put it in a jar, with some water, and let it sit. Certain things will give your garden certain nutrients. And I personally like it because your still using every bit of the fruit/Veg/etc., and if your like me and cant have a compost where your at, its just as good.
